The … WebWhen using a de-esser, follow these 4 simple steps to make sure you get it right every time. Find the frequency where sibilance is most present. Set your threshold (or sensitivity) so the de-esser is only turning on when sibilance is present. Turn up the de-esser’s strength until the vocalist “S’s” and “T’s” are hard to hear.
